India's count of cases of the coronavirus disease (Covid-19) crossed 8.9 million mark to reach 8,912,907 on Wednesday, Union health ministry's data showed. In the previous spike, 29,164 new infections were recorded and 30,458 in the one before that. The latest spike is 32% more than the previous one.

Meanwhile, the Arvind Kejriwal-led government in Delhi announced it was limiting the number of people allowed at weddings to 50 from 200. Also, both Delhi deputy CM Manish Sisodia and health minister Satyendar Jain assured no new lockdown would be imposed in the national capital. Jain, however, also hinted at curbs at local level in certain areas to bring Delhi's Covid-19 situation under control.

There will be no lockdown but local curbs can be there: Delhi health minister

There'll be no lockdown but there can be local restrictions at some busy places. Maximum tests are being conducted which we'll further increase. The virus can easily spread due to large gatherings during Chhath Pooja hence the restrictions: Satyendar Jain

India crosses 8.9 million Covid-19 cases; 38,617 in last 24 hours

India records 38,617 new Covid-19 cases as tally crosses 8.9 million to reach 8,912,907. 474 new fatalities take death toll to 130,993 while active cases are at 446,805.
